With 4000 geese (almost half of them Tundra Bean Geese and Greater White-Fronted Geese) the number was only two thirds of that of December, with no Swan Geese visible; probably many migrated further South. Also, Han River was full with drifting ice and almost no gulls or ducks were visible.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">However, the number of small birds, in particular buntings, seems to have increased a lot, with among others more than 400 Rustic Buntings, a globally vulnerable species seen.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">You can find the full list at: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p
